11 The Lord did this,
and it is ·wonderful [amazing; marvelous] ·to us [for us to see; L in our eyes; Ps. 118:22–23].’”
12 The Jewish leaders knew that the ·story [parable] was about them. So they ·wanted to find a way [were seeking/trying] to arrest Jesus, but they were afraid of the people. So the leaders left him and went away.
Is It Right to Pay Taxes or Not?(A)
13 Later, the Jewish leaders sent some Pharisees and Herodians [C a political group that supported king Herod and his family; 3:6] to Jesus to ·trap [catch] him in saying something wrong.
